The Appeal of Tiny Homes

One of the main reasons why tiny homes have become so popular is their affordability. With soaring housing prices in many cities, owning a traditional home has become increasingly out of reach for many people. Tiny homes offer a more affordable alternative, allowing individuals to achieve homeownership without breaking the bank. Additionally, the smaller footprint of these homes means reduced utility costs and lower maintenance expenses.

Another reason why tiny homes have gained traction is their sustainable nature. These homes are often built using eco-friendly materials and are designed to be energy-efficient. With a smaller space to heat or cool, tiny homes consume significantly less energy compared to their larger counterparts. Furthermore, many tiny home enthusiasts embrace off-grid living, utilizing solar power and composting toilets to minimize their impact on the environment.

The Freedom of Minimalism

Tiny homes have also become a symbol of the minimalist movement, which advocates for living with less and focusing on experiences rather than material possessions. By downsizing their living space, individuals can declutter their lives and prioritize what truly matters to them. This newfound freedom from material possessions allows for a simpler and more intentional lifestyle.

Living in a tiny home also encourages individuals to make conscious choices about their belongings. With limited storage space, people must carefully consider what they truly need and value. This shift in mindset promotes mindful consumption and reduces waste, leading to a more sustainable way of living.

Designing for Efficiency and Creativity

One of the fascinating aspects of tiny homes is their innovative design. Despite their limited square footage, these homes are often cleverly designed to maximize space and functionality. Multi-purpose furniture, such as beds that convert into tables or storage compartments, are common in tiny homes. Additionally, creative storage solutions, such as hidden cabinets and loft spaces, allow for efficient use of every inch.

Living in a tiny home also encourages individuals to think outside the box and find creative solutions to everyday challenges. From vertical gardens to portable kitchens, tiny homeowners often showcase their ingenuity through unique and personalized designs. The limited space pushes people to be resourceful and find inventive ways to live comfortably within a smaller footprint.
